Measuring is likely one of the most important things you need to get used to doing competently once you begin woodworking for yourself. In many ways, measuring is probably the most fundamental talent that you will have to teach yourself. There are lots of widespread problems that pop up in woodworking (like poorly becoming joints) that usually get traced again to some kind of drawback within the measuring stage.
Typically, loads of your measuring issues are going to be the results of utilizing the fallacious equipment. Give it some thought- there are going to be a quantity otherwise angled and formed items of wooden concerned in making whatever you wish to make, and a tape measurer is not going to be precise sufficient for all of them. Familiarize yourself with all of the different measuring tools ( including precision t-guidelines and bending rulers, miter squares, sliding bevels, angle guides and finders, and calipers) will take you a good distance in direction of with the ability to measure precisely at each stage of the project.
You're additionally going to wish to have the ability to learn plans to properly assemble your project. It isn't vital that you understand how to attract up your personal woodworking plans, however it's crucial that you can learn others. The plan is the fundamental blueprint that tells you the way to make the desk or furnishings you are attempting. Good plans can be extremely detailed and will have plenty of step-by-step directions and illustrations, as well as a materials list.
Sanding and ending might be going to be last skill that it's essential master with DIY woodworking. This stage comes when the entire challenge is full and also you're ready to offer it that polished and professional appearance that all of us crave in our picket furniture. There are a number of devices that you can use to sand down your finished product to a clean, shiny, glass-like texture. Essentially the most fundamental is either utilizing your hand or a rubber hand-held sandpaper grip (which are good for detail work and curved pieces), while more complicated tools like orbital sanders are going to be extra applicable for larger, flatter surfaces you must sand down.
Finishing is the process of staining and sealing the wooden to present it a definite colour and to make it waterproof. Staining wooden is quite a bit like portray wooden, besides stains are designed to look like it is simply the pure coloring of the wood. Like portray, you are going to must put down a couple of layers of stain to guantee that it goes on as evenly and totally as possible. Once you might be glad with the stain job, you'll be able to then use a sealant to protect the wooden and the stain from water and different elements.
